Struggles for Puerto Rican Independence

This chapter examines the tumultuous relationship between the U.S. and its annexed territories, particularly Puerto Rico, and the resistance against colonial rule. It highlights the activism of Pedro Albizu Campos and the shifts from political engagement to violent protest within the Nationalist Party. Through the lens of government surveillance and oppressive measures, the chapter sheds light on the psychological toll imposed on those fighting for Puerto Rican independence.
